The Confirmation Letter example in Virginia serves as a formal acknowledgment of a settlement agreement reached between two parties, typically following a legal proceeding. This model letter outlines the essential terms of the agreement, including details about payments and property returns relevant to the case. It is designed for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ants who need to document settlements clearly and professionally. Users are instructed to personalize the letter with specific details such as dates, amounts, and names to fit their circumstances. The letter facilitates a smooth transition into payment arrangements and the cessation of collection efforts, ensuring all parties are aligned. For optimal use, professionals should review the content for accuracy and completeness before sending. This letter also provides a space for signatures, fostering agreement and accountability. Its structured format allows readers to easily identify key points and obligations, making it an invaluable tool in legal practices.

Tips to write a Confirmation Letter in a professional tone: Use a formal tone and language throughout the letter. Clearly state the details of the agreement or arrangement being confirmed. Include relevant dates, times, and locations. Provide contact information in case the recipient has any questions or concerns.

Confirmation Letter Format Header: Includes the company's name, address, and official contact information. Date: Includes the date on which the letter is being sent. Recipient's information: Includes the recipient's name, title, and official address. Subject: It describes the purpose of the letter.

A confirmation letter is a memo professionals write in response to an offer or invitation, such as whether they can attend an event, such as reservations, business meetings or appointments. You may also use confirmation letters to document verbal agreements in writing or respond to a job offer .
